post.categories
|
||||
The list of categories to which this post belongs. Categories are
|
||||
derived from the directory structure above the _posts directory. For
|
||||
example, a post at /work/code/_posts/2008-12-24-closures.textile
|
||||
would have this field set to ['work', 'code'].
|
||||
|
||||
post.topics
|
||||
The list of topics for this Post. Topics are derived from the directory
|
||||
structure beneath the _posts directory. For example, a post at
|
||||
/_posts/music/metal/2008-12-24-metalocalypse.textile would have this field
|
||||
set to ['music', 'metal'].
